Key Features and Benefits
- OptiPoint Optical Switches: The keyboard features SteelSeries QX2 Red optical switches, designed for fast actuation and durability. These switches offer a spectacular response time, ideal for competitive gaming.
- Compact TKL Design: With its tenkeyless (TKL) design, the Apex 9 is portable and saves desk space without sacrificing key functionality, making it easy to carry and perfect for tournaments.
- RGB Backlighting: Customizable RGB lighting allows you to personalize your keyboard with stunning colors and effects, enhancing your gaming setup
- Durable Aluminum Frame: Built with an aluminum construction, this keyboard offers durability while remaining lightweight at just 2.3 pounds, making it sturdy yet easy to transport.
- Ergonomic Design: The keyboard’s ambidextrous hand orientation caters to all gamers, ensuring comfort during extended play sessions. The compact layout reduces wrist strain and enhances comfort.
- Multiple Media Controls: With nine dedicated buttons, controlling your audio and game features has never been easier, allowing quick access during gameplay.

Customer Reviews: What Gamers are Saying
Customer feedback on the SteelSeries Apex 9 TKL has been overwhelmingly positive. Reviewers frequently praise its responsive keys and overall build quality. Many appreciate the customizable RGB lighting, allowing users to adapt their keyboard’s appearance to match their gaming setup.
Despite the outstanding features, a few users note minor drawbacks. Some have mentioned the absence of dedicated function keys and a built-in wrist rest, which could enhance comfort during extended gaming marathons. However, most feel that the compact design compensates for these aspects.

This keyboard has everything you want for gaming. Only 0.7ms input lag on rtings which is really good. The new optical switches are really consistent and I love how I can switch the actuation point depending on if I’m gaming or typing. The choice between 3 levels of elevation is also nice.
For gaming, this is one of the best keyboards you can possibly get. I’m a high-mmr CSGO player and I can tell you this delivers. Your counter-strafing and ability to stop on a dime is amazing. This keyboard can take as many inputs at once as you can press and doesn’t have cord splitting or other artifacts. It’s true 1000hz polling too.
You also have a good USB-C cord that’s braided and detachable. You can also keep the tool under the keyboard if you travel to LANs or in general. It’s perfect. You also have onboard memory and it’s very easy to use the SteelSeries software to configure. It’s easy to update firmware as well.
The build quality is very good too. They used aluminum in the body and the higher quality PBT keycaps. Also, if anything breaks, you can easily replace the keycaps OR the switches themselves and SteelSeries actively sells replacement parts unlike Logitech for example who only sells switches and not keycaps.
There’s really nothing I can complain about. The only thing maybe is that some keyboards like the wooting have release triggered as soon as your key starts going back up. However the wooting has slightly more input lag on direct press and CSGO, Valorant, and most games honestly favor new inputs over releasing inputs anyway. Also some keyboards like the Corsair K65 have 8000hz polling rate which is insane.
However with that being said, the 8000hz polling and early release triggering from those competitors really aren’t a big deal and have their own downsides – especially the 8000hz polling because it can actually take up some more cpu usage so I don’t think it’s necessarily efficient at the sub 1ms level.
Overall, I looked at all of the popular keyboards for gaming in this price range and this one was the best for the price for my setup. I didn’t talk much about typing btw but I am a megaracer on typeracer.com and it feels very good to type on in the 1.5mm mode + 7deg incline. If you’re looking for a gaming keyboard, look no further, this has literally everything with no downsides.

had a hyperx origins 60%, this ones clearly better and faster as the actuation point is 1.0mm instead of the 1.8mm on the hyperx. it is very light and surprisingly very nice for the money. you cant actually change the actuation point except from switching from gaming (1.0mm) to “writing?” (1.5mm)
looks very nice with its full just black color, i am having problems with the rgb randomly turning on even though i fully turned it off. i did already end up ordering some white keycaps off of aliexpress so ill add a pic after i actually put them on.
